Date: 21 January 2021 12:28:55 Hi Lucy Our Board have no objections to this application, there were comments regarding having two meter boxes on the front of the property, however we understand from Manx Utilities that unless it is a designated conservation area then they require them to be on the front for safety and access reasons.
